Purpose
The Guidelines concerning Behaviour in Business contain
a number of basics with respect to a fair business policy
and a correct behaviour towards customers, suppliers,
competitors, employees, authorities and the public in
general. They serve as an assistance of a company's
staff in its daily business activities.
By adopting the Guidelines concerning Behaviour in
Business, the managing directors meet the obligation
to teach a behaviour in business that considers international
legal standards.
